Just to make things clear(ish), some of the models I was using had to be stand-ins as Vassal doesn't have models for the Banshee or Sylyss yet. The mission was Close Quarters. I deployed first, and kept my guys in nice groups so they could benefit from their armour bonuses. The banshee would help the invictors get Flank. Adam's Errants would be coming up fast so I had to deal with them quickly.
After the first turn, we have both moved up. Adam also used his feat, which makes it so if I kill any of his infantry the offending model takes a point of damage. His daughters of the flame, very fast with true path, ran up to bother narn and get in my objective.
Adam's feat didn't stop me from attacking them though! My invictors paired up for combined ranged attacks and whittled down the errants. My sentinels tried to chop the daughters but had a hard time hitting. Then they took a couple of casualties, but I was happy because then I get to use granted, vengeance! Additionally, the knights exemplar ran forward to fight my invictors, hoping their steadily increasing armour would protect them.
My invictors, mat 9 weaponmasters with flank, did a good bit of damage to the exemplars. Narn is floating around the back being threatening, and our jacks are doing some damage to each other in combat. Also, that Vilmon character is functionally invincible as I don't have any magic weapons on my left side.
At this point I should have taken a picture at the end of my turn, as things were looking good for me. Ravynn had flew forward and hopped into the scoring zone, killing lots of Adam's infantry on the way. My Banshee, with the boost from the arcanist, killed Adam's heavy jack on that side. I also got one objective point. When Adam's turn came around, the banshee's scream ability became quite useful as it prevented the Daughters of the Flame from charging Ravyn. Nothing else could really reach her, so Adam had no choice but to run up and cast immolation on her twice. The second one got a critical hit, lighting her on fire.
Then my upkeep came and she...
burned to death. Adam won, but if I hadn't died in the fire I would have been able to get Vilmon out of the zone and won on scenario.
